Overview of the IPO
PayPay Corporation, a subsidiary of LINE Yahoo Corporation, commenced the roadshow for the Initial Public Offering of American Depositary Shares (ADS) on the U.S. stock exchange on March 2, 2026 (U.S. time). The offering consists of 31,054,254 ADS newly issued by PayPay and 23,932,960 ADS sold by selling shareholder SVF II Piranha (DE) LLC, totaling 54,987,214 ADS for the offering and secondary offering. Additionally, an overallotment option allowing for the purchase of up to 8,248,081 additional ADS is expected to be granted. The indicative price range is between 17 and 20 USD per ADS, with a listing application filed for the NASDAQ Global Select Market under the ticker "PAYP."
Domestic Secondary Offering and Future Outlook
As part of this offering, a domestic secondary offering of 8,653,079 ADS is planned, with subscription acceptance scheduled from March 3 to 7, 2026. Mizuho Securities Co., Ltd. and PayPay Securities Co., Ltd. will serve respectively as the handling securities firm and delegated sales securities firm. LINE Yahoo Corporation will maintain PayPay as a consolidated subsidiary after completion of this IPO, and significant impact on consolidated financial results or position is not anticipated.
